Tajikistan, Switzerland, Qatar, Azizi Deliver Aid To Quake-Hit Afghans
KABUL (Pajhwok): As national and international aid continues to pour in, Tajikistan, Switzerland and the Azizi Charity Foundation have sent humanitarian assistance, while Qatar has established a temporary field hospital to provide urgent medical services to those affected by the earthquake in eastern Afghanistan.
Tajikistan has dispatched more than 3,000 tonnes of humanitarian aid to the earthquake-hit people in Afghanistan.
Following instructions from President Emomali Rahmon, the aid was sent to assist those affected by the recent powerful earthquake, Trend reported.
The aid, transported by a convoy of trucks, includes 24 types of essential goods and materials such as flour, oil, sugar, rice, bedding, clothing and shoes for children, adolescents, and adults, tents and construction materials including rebar, boards, roofing sheets, cement, and other items. The total shipment exceeds 3,000 tonnes.
This initiative reflects the compassion of the Tajik people towards their Afghan neighbours and highlights Tajikistan's humanitarian and neighbourly policy.
Meanwhile, the Afghan Red Crescent Society (ARCS) said that the Swiss Agency for Development and Cooperation (SDC) has delivered 20 tonnes of non-food humanitarian assistance to meet the basic needs of earthquake victims in Kunar.
In a statement, the ARCS noted that the aid was formally handed over at Kabul International Airport to Mohammad Saleh Akhundzada, Director of Disaster Management at the ARCS, by Pamela Stathakis, Deputy Head of SDC in Kabul and Advisor Ahmad Saleem.
Akhundzada expressed deep appreciation for SDC's humanitarian support and emphasised that the assistance would be distributed transparently to the earthquake-affected communities in Kunar.
In her remarks, Stathakis highlighted SDC's commitment to addressing the needs of those impacted by natural disasters in Afghanistan.
She also pledged to provide further assistance to support the relief and well-being of the earthquake-affected communities in Kunar. The shipment includes 310 tents and 300 packages of winter clothing, which will soon be delivered to affected households in the province.
Azizi Bank also posted on its Facebook page that the Azizi Charity Foundation's aid convoy has reached Mazar Dara village in Nurgal district of Kunar province.
It said the aid includes cash assistance, flour, oil, rice, blankets, carpets, and clothing for children.
Meanwhile, according to a Qatari media report by QNA, the Qatar International Search and Rescue Group, part of the Internal Security Force (Lekhwiya), has set up a temporary field hospital to provide urgent medical support to those affected by the earthquake that struck eastern Afghanistan.
The group reported that the hospital has already admitted several injured individuals and provided them with necessary care, while critical cases have been transferred to main hospitals in neighbouring provinces.
In addition, the Qatar International Search and Rescue Group has established several shelter tents to provide temporary accommodation for families affected by the earthquake and to ensure their basic needs are met.
The earthquake, which struck shortly before Sunday night, affected Kunar, Nangarhar, Laghman, Panjshir, and Nuristan provinces, causing the most casualties and damage in Kunar.
According to official figures, the death toll in Kunar has reached 2,205, with 3,640 injured.
